/// /// \file cafeEnumStrings.h /// \author Jan Chrin, PSI /// \date Release: February 2015 /// \version CAFE 1.0.0 /// #ifndef CAFEENUMSTRINGS_H #define CAFEENUMSTRINGS_H #include #include template<> char const * enumStrings::data[] = {"CAFENUM::WAIT", "CAFENUM::NO_WAIT"}; template<> char const * enumStrings::data[] = {"CAFENUM::NATIVE_DATATYPE", "CAFENUM::LOWEST_DATATYPE"}; template<> char const * enumStrings::data[] = {"CAFENUM::WITH_FLUSH_IO","CAFENUM::WITH_PEND_IO","CAFENUM::WITH_PEND_EVENT", "CAFENUM::WITH_POLL"}; template<> char const * enumStrings::data[] = {"CAFENUM::FLUSH_AFTER_EACH_MESSAGE","CAFENUM::FLUSH_DESIGNATED_TO_CLIENT"}; template<> char const * enumStrings::data[] = {"CAFENUM::WITHOUT_CALLBACK","CAFENUM::WITH_CALLBACK_DEFAULT","CAFENUM::WITH_CALLBACK_USER_SUPPLIED"}; template<> char const * enumStrings::data[] = {"CAFENUM::DBR_PRIMITIVE","CAFENUM::DBR_STS","CAFENUM::DBR_TIME", "CAFENUM::DBR_GR", "CAFENUM::DBR_CTRL","CAFENUM::DBR_PUT", "CAFENUM::DBR_STSACK","CAFENUM::DBR_CLASS", "CAFENUM::DBR_OTHER" }; template<> char const * enumStrings::data[] = {"CAFENUM::NO_MESSAGE","CAFENUM::PRE_REQUEST","CAFENUM::FROM_REQUEST","CAFENUM::FROM_PEND", "CAFENUM::FROM_CALLBACK" }; template<> char const * enumStrings::data[] = {"CAFENUM::NOT_INITIATED","CAFENUM::PENDING","CAFENUM::COMPLETE"}; #endif // CAFEENUMSTRINGS_H